    • Close the Blinds. Once you have gathered all of your cleaning supplies and the vacuum, lower horizontal blinds or draw vertical blinds over the window so they are fully extended.
    • Vacuum Away Dust. Use a vacuum with a hose and upholstery brush attachment to easily dust the blinds. If you don't have an appropriate vacuum, you can also dust the blinds by wiping down each slat with a microfiber cloth.
    • Inspect for Stains. After dusting, inspect the blinds for stains from splattered food, sticky hands, or insect droppings.
    • Mix a Cleaning Solution. Place two cups of lukewarm water in a bowl and add a few drops (no more than 1/4 teaspoon) dishwashing liquid. Agitate the water with your fingers or a spoon to disperse the dishwashing liquid.

  7. Jan 17, 2024 · Follow these steps: Dust the blinds. Soak them in warm water and dish soap (as outlined above). Drain the water out of the tub and replace it with fresh water. Add about 2 cups of chlorine bleach to the water, then let the blinds soak in the bleach solution for 10-15 minutes before rinsing again and drying thoroughly.
